That was shady: Man steals $15K in sunglasses from B.C. shop

Thief who broke into an optical store in Gibsons just after 4:30 a.m. June 1, grabbed approximately $15,000 worth of sunglasses.
While 1980’s Canadian rocker Corey Hart sang about the virtues of ‘sunglasses at night’, the Sunshine Coast RCMP is seeking help identifying a male that took that message one step too far by breaking into an optical store in Gibsons on June 1, at approximately 4:40 a.m.

Stolen during that incident was approximately $15,000 worth of sunglasses, primarily Oakley brand.

Surveillance video for the store, located in the 1100 block of Sunshine Coast Highway, shows the suspect smashing the glass front door to gain entrance. He was wearing a dark grey or black jacket (although it appears white in the photos), dark pants and was carrying a reusable shopping bag. The male appears to be of average build and is approximately 5'8", wears glasses and possibly has a moustache.
